Immediate Steps to Take

Here’s a quick list of things you can do if you forget your bank name while attempting a mobile deposit:

  • Check your banking app: Most banking apps display the bank name on the homepage or under the account section.
  • Look at previous statements: If you have access to older bank statements, they will clearly indicate the bank's name.
  • Auto-saved logins: Check your saved passwords or login preferences in your phone's settings for hints.

Double-Check Important Details

When setting up your mobile deposit, it's crucial to ensure all information is correct. Remember to:

  • Confirm the routing and account numbers are accurate.
  • Ensure the check endorsements meet bank requirements.
  • Double-check mobile deposit limits for your account.
